ILKLEY:
Geographical and Historical information from the year 1829.

"ILKLEY, a village, in the parish of its name, in the wapentake of Skyrack, is six miles from Otley, much frequented in the summer for the benefit of its cold spring, which issues from the sides of a high hill overlooking the village, and the bath is deemed highly salutary in relaxed and scorbutic cases. The population is about 500."
Note: The directory entry for Ilkley in Pigot's 1829 Directory is included with Skipton.

[Transcribed from Pigot's National Commericial Directory for 1828-29 ]
